10483 people attended a rock festival. if there were 811 more boys than girls, and 2481 fewer adults over 50 years of age than t
Bond [772]

Answer: 4051 girls, 4862 boys and 1570 adults over 50 years of age group attended the festival.

Step-by-step explanation:

Let x denotes the number of girls.

Then, the number of boys = x+811

The number of adults over 50 years of age = x-2481

Now, by considering the given scenario :-

x+x+811+x-2481=10483\\\\\Rightarrow\ 3x-1670=10483\\\\\Rightarrow\ 3x=10483+1670\\\\\Rightarrow\ 3x=12153\\\\\Rightarrow\ x=\dfrac{12153}{3}=4051

Thus, the number of girls attended the festival = 4051,

Then number of boys = 4051+811=4862

Number of adults = 4051-2481=1570

Balu had a collection of coins. 1/2 of the coins are from asian countries, 1/3 of them from european countries, 36 are from amer
Georgia [21]

The total number of coins Balu had in his collection was <u>216 coins</u>, computed using the linear equation in one variable, <u>x = x/2 + x/3 + 36</u>.

Asian coins were 1/2 a fraction of this, that is, (1/2)*216 = <u>108 coins</u>.

We assume the total coins with Balu to be x.

The fraction of coins from Asian countries = 1/2.

Thus, the number of coins from the Asian countries = 1/2 of x = x/2.

The fraction of coins from European countries = 1/3.

Thus, the number of coins from the European countries = 1/3 of x = x/3.

The number of coins from America = 36.

Thus, the total number of coins = x/2 + x/3 + 36.

But, we assumed that the total number of coins is x.

Thus, we get a linear equation in one variable as follows:

x = x/2 + x/3 + 36.

We solve this equation as follows:

x = x/2 + x/3 + 36,

or, x - x/2 - x/3 = 36,

or, (6x - 3x - 2x)/6 = 36,

or, x/6 = 36,

or, x = 36*6 = 216.
